Steele et al v. Seattle Theatre Group et al

Filing 22

MINUTE ORDER re parties' 20 STIPULATION AND PROPOSED ORDER on First Amended Summons and First Amended Complaint for Declaratory and Injunctive Relief, to Dismiss Neptune Building LLC without Prejudice and Without Fees or Costs to Either Pa rty, and Acceptance of Service of Process. The attorneys for Plaintiff and Defendants stipulate and agree that: (1) Counsel for Plaintiff may file without opposition the attached First Amended Summons and First Amended Complaint For Declaratory a nd Injunctive Relief with the Clerk of the Court; and (2) Defendant, The Neptune Building, LLC, is hereby DISMISSED from this action without prejudice and without an award of fees or costs to either party. Authorized by U.S. District Judge John C Coughenour. (TH)
